We took my father down to Captiva (off the coast of Ft.Myers, just past Sanibel) for a long weekend to celebrate his 65th birthday. South Seas is a huge place neatly divided into many parts. Very friendly to kids of all ages with the main attraction being the sizable pool area (growing even bigger-a water park is under construction). The nearly deserted beach, tennis courts, golf and marina hold even bigger kids and adults captivated. South Seas offers a wide array of lodging--providing options for those with varying budgets and very smartly, varying family sizes. The food is adequate for this type of resort and each restaurant has menus, crayons and special cups for young kids. One drawback is that they are a bit pricey and because of the island's isolation you don't have much choice other than hotel grub. All in all, our 2 year old had a blast during the days and slept well at night. So did Mom and Dad and so did Grandpa and Grandma. It's hard to ask for much more from a quick long weekend.
